What Comes Aroundreleased on Demand on August 4th 2023. The drama-thriller film stars Kyle Gallner, Grace Van Dien, Summer Phoenix, and Jesse Garcia. It runs for approximately 85 minutes.
An internet love affair spirals out of control when Eric decides to show up at Anna's house to surprise her for her birthday, leading to an unpredictable game of cat-and-mouse.

What Comes Around is an unconventional romantic thriller that kept me guessing until the end. Is it worthy of your next watch? Let's find out...
The Pros:

A juicy twist!
Wow...I did not see that coming! At first glance, this film seemed like a modern day version of Fear (starring Mark Wahlberg and Reese Witherspoon), but it took an unexpected turn and went in a completely different direction.
It was shocking and really interesting.

Kyle Gallner does it again!
I just recently watched him in The Passenger (a fantastic performance) and here he goes again with this film! He always immerses himself into whatever role he is playing and I think he elevated this film in a lot of ways.
I'm not sure if I would have liked it as much without him. He really draws you in and makes you think with his performances. There were a lot of moving parts to this particular movie and I think he poured a lot into his character to keep the audience invested until the end.
The Cons:

Needed a little more edge...
There were so many little moments in this film that felt like they were building up to something else. While I didn't need it to go full Lifetime here, I thought we were going to get some deranged moments, but they never really came.
That being said, I appreciate that this film decided to stay true to its intention, focusing more on the consequences of past actions while using a realistic approach to show the impact of the ending.
I guess I was just expecting something a little more explosive, but it still worked.
So am I in or out?
Images courtesy of IFC Films
I'm in!
A unique and realistic thriller that makes you contemplate the impact one's past actions can really have on others.
This film was not what I was expecting, but I thoroughly enjoyed it.
